The course provides guidance on how to introduce social analysis into investment programmes and projects. In particular, it describes how to use social analysis in the project cycle, the sustainable livelihoods framework, the main entry points for conducting social analysis, and how to integrate the findings into the project design. It also illustrates the methods for collecting information and the key participatory tools for social analysis fieldwork, providing job aids such as checklists, templates and “field tools flashcards” for mission work.
